Evolve Education deliver its first NVQ training programmes

  • Posted by Josh Cronin
  • On 13th November 2007

As part of Evolve’s Skills Pledge to its workforce, both organisations are committed to the training and development of all staff so that they may reach their true potential. This meeting of key Evolve Education staff demonstrates the importance that all Evolve companies place upon quality delivery and providing the best possible preparation for their employees to enter the workplace.

John Bishop, director of Evolve Education, says “Since 2003, Evolve Sport has paved the way for the external delivery of physical engagement activities into primary schools throughout England and Wales. We are now entering a new phase in this exciting industry development by providing specialised and nationally accredited training for sports coaches who wish to embark upon a career in this sector and qualified teachers who want to focus their attention solely upon the provision of primary school PE, dance and sport.”
